WebNov 25, 2024 · Milanos were invented by accident. Instagram. While Milanos have become arguably one of Pepperidge Farm's most popular cookies (there are now 19 flavors, from pumpkin spice to dark chocolate sea salt to key lime), the original cookie actually began as a complete accident as the result of an unexpected issue with shipping.
